    What should this weapon be called?

    I have a concept for a new weapon in mind, but I can't think of a good name for it.

    Basic concept is that someone takes a Imperium's lasgun and converts it to accept Tau Pulse Rifle energy cell. This hybrid improves its ability to penetrate and range. For all intents and purposes it's a Pulse Rifle -2 Str, or the old Ordos Helgun with +6" Range.

    Right now I'm using a temporary name of PLaser, but it just doesn't flow right.

    Thoughts, ideas?

    Edit: Stats would be useful, yes? There will also be a Pistol, Carbine, and Salvo version of the weapon, too.

    Weapon.............Range..Str..AP..Type
    {Plaser Rifle?}.....30"......3.....5.....Rapid-Fire

    Okay... A little background information is apparently needed:

    Short fluff version: Humans conquered by Tau for several centuries. Tau are gone now. The humans left can recreate lasguns and Pulse Rifle Cells, but not Pulse Rifles. The P Rifle Cells provide more power than the lasgun cells do, allowing for stronger bursts of energy, but lack the punch of true Pulse weapons.

    Short Gameplay version: I wanted a unique small arm that wasn't a lasgun/boltgun/pulse rifle pt deux. Helguns aren't in use anymore (unless they are available to Inquisitorial Troops, still, I don't have the GK codex, yet). And this one has a little more range than the standard Helgun had. (stats posted in edited OP).
